On Thu, Dec 11, 2014 at 4:12 AM, Mick Sulley <m...@sulley.info> wrote: > Don't know if this will help but this is my list to install on a Pi, it > includes other stuff as well as owfs so you may not need all of it. > > sudo apt-get update > sudo apt-get -y dist-upgrade > sudo rpi-update > sudo apt-get install i2c-tools > sudo apt-get install apache2 > sudo apt-get install php5 > sudo apt-get install php5-cgi > sudo apt-get install php5-mysql > sudo apt-get install libfuse-dev > sudo apt-get install libusb-dev > sudo apt-get install libavahi-client-dev > sudo apt-get install swig > sudo apt-get install fuse-utils > sudo apt-get install automake > sudo apt-get install python-pexpect > sudo apt-get install mysql-server > you will be prompted to create a root password > sudo apt-get install python-mysqldb > sudo apt-get install owfs > > > On 11/12/14 04:34, Gregg Levine wrote: >> Hello! >> I did try one or two of their methods, and would you believe, I >> couldn't make things work.
